Would the II/KG76 Ju-88 a1's be better in Tramecourt. They were based in Creil France south of Arras. Having them operating on the front lines from a fighter base will mean people will be hopping into them for easy frontline access for divebombing. But the limit is 10 and I feel they will be wasted. There are plenty of Ju-87's and Bf-110's to throw away for that. Another idea would be fictional location air base on the edge of the map closest in line with the real starting bombers bases.

And I think there is one other fighter base near coast with Ju-88's, they would be better starting from deep France.
